Sydney couple experiences fairytale wedding and honeymoon in South Africa Sydney newlyweds, Sian and Rob Ashdown, are still on cloud nine after returning from South Africa where they were married at the amazing bushveld of Northern KwaZulu Natal. The couple, who returned to their homeland for the special occasion, and their guests enjoyed an exclusive intimate ceremony in a dry river bed, under an ancient fig tree and beautiful gazebo in the Rhino Reserve. “Our trip was magical and an absolutely surreal experience. Marrying Rob under the oldest fig tree in the Rhino Reserve, where two elephants and their baby calf grazed so close to us for the entire ceremony, was just incredible. They were so close we could hear their stomachs rumbling! “What other place in the world would this happen? South Africa is the perfect destination wedding location. Our guests enjoyed a once in a life time experience with the elephants, traditional Zulu dancers and a decadent dinner under the African stars,” said Rob. Following their fairy-tale wedding, the couple travelled to South Africa’s renowned Cape wine lands for their honeymoon. “My favourite parts of the trip were spending time with my wife doing amazing things like cycling through the Cape Point Nature Reserve, enjoying a romantic picnic and soaking in South Africa’s natural beauty, and strolling through Franschoek watching the sunset,” said Rob. “South Africa is so unique and has everything your heart desires. We were amazed and awestruck by the beauty and level of incredible hospitality, through to the kindness of the local people and how far the Australian dollar goes. I would recommend South Africa as a wedding and honeymoon destination in a heartbeat. We can’t wait to return,” concluded Sian.
